TV Programmes Morecambe and Wise from their TV show starring Glenda Jackson - A Nostalgic Trip Down Memory Lane

EDITORS COMMENTS
. Step back in time with this print capturing the iconic British comedy duo, Morecambe and Wise, alongside the talented actress Glenda Jackson. Taken during a 1970s episode of their beloved television program, this image is a true testament to the golden era of entertainment. In an era where laughter was abundant and family-friendly humor reigned supreme, Eric Morecambe and Ernie Wise enchanted audiences across the nation with their impeccable comedic timing and infectious chemistry. This photograph perfectly encapsulates their unique brand of wit as they share the screen with acclaimed actress Glenda Jackson. As you gaze upon this snapshot from yesteryear, memories flood back of evenings spent gathered around the television set, eagerly awaiting another side-splitting installment from these legendary comedians. Their sketches were filled with clever wordplay, slapstick antics, and unforgettable catchphrases that have stood the test of time. This print not only serves as a delightful memento for fans but also acts as a window into an era when innocent laughter brought families together. It reminds us of simpler times when TV programs like those featuring Morecambe and Wise provided much-needed respite from everyday life.
